This bug may be on purpose, but I've noticed that the Mouse wheel scrolls
documents even if their scrollbars have been turned off. This can be seen with
FRAME/IFRAMEs with scrolling="no" or with any document with html { overflow:
hidden; } (in a frame or not).

Steps to reproduce:
1. Goto above URL (http://wulffmorgenthaler.com/)
2. Move mouse over the comic strip
3. Scroll mouse wheel down and see IFRAME scroll

This is fixed on trunk, but I don't know what bug number
Disabling mouse wheel scrolling of overflow:hidden elements was done in Bug 259615.
